Q: How do I redeem with my MBP camera if gift card image inverted?

I just recently received a MacBook Pro retina display and have tried to use the camera to redeem a music card code.   The problem is that the image is a mirror image of the actual card, so it cannot be read by iTunes.    Is there a way to set up the camera so the image is not inverted?   Is this a recognized issue that will be fixed?   I did ask someone at an Apple store and was told to try the forum- they were not aware of the issue. 

 

By the way- I also tried this with my 2009 iMac and have the same issue- so it is not unique to the MBP.   I think it worked years ago- perhaps an issue with later versions of iTunes?   Thanks for any help.

    The code should be recognized even though the card image is reversed. Note, though, that the card must have the focus box around the code. Cards that lack this will not work via the camera. If yours has that box but still isn't recognized by the camera, it may be an anomaly with the card, assuming that you've complete scratched off the coating. I'd suggest that you just type in the code rather than spending a lot of time trying to get the camera method to work.

    The free song cards I've seen from Starbucks lack that focus box and hence won't work via the camera.
